You will only pay for what you use, so don’t worry if you have extra moving boxes lying around. There are various types of moving boxes you can request, including dish packs and wardrobe boxes. Dish packs come equipped with separated cubbies for glasses and mugs. Wardrobe boxes are tall and come with a cardboard rod to hang your clothing on. Of course, I also have boxes of all sizes for anything from bedding to books.

If you’re looking to collect some used moving boxes, beware that a used box is structurally weaker than a new one. Ask your moving and storage company for gently used boxes, or stick with new ones. The longer your belongings will be in moving boxes, the sturdier the box should be. Naturally, my coworkers and I are here if you have any questions before, during and after moving day.

Here are a few tips to help keep you focused during a hectic move:

1) Have a Plan – Move heavy items first, when you’re more rested. Move boxes room by room, starting at one end of the house and making your way to the opposite end.
2) It’s Not a Race! – Don’t walk too quickly while carrying heavy items. Also, refrain from trying to lift bulky items without the help of another mover.

1) It’s time to create your furniture floor plan. Make a rough sketch of your new space and decide how you would like your furniture arranged. You can even color-code your furniture by room. Preplanning will make your move easier, and your Dallas movers will make sure each piece is placed as you want it. This way, you won’t have to move your heavy items and rearrange everything after the movers have left.

2) If you live in a multi-unit complex, particularly a high-rise, make preparations for a smooth move out of the community. Some communities can reserve a freight elevator at your request, giving your movers access and much-needed space to safely move your belongings without imposing on other residents. Check to see if loading docks or special parking are available and make a reservation for your moving day. Access to a dock will help your professional movers load your items more efficiently.

Cinco de Mayo is a highly-celebrated holiday in Mexico commemorating the Mexican army’s defeat of the French army at the Battle of Puebla in 1862. The battle is famous as an underdog success story. The French army was notably better-equiped than Mexican forces and had remained undefeated for 50 years. The holiday is celebrated throughout Mexico and the United States with gatherings that include food, music and dancing…and maybe a cerveza or two!
